NEWARK WATER DEPARTMENT EPA Drinking Water Compliance Record

TapScore summarizes EPA Safe Drinking Water Information System records for public water system NJ0714001. It does not test household tap water or determine whether water is currently safe to drink.

How to read this grade

Grade C means “Some recent records” under TapScore's published method. It is a comparison of recent EPA compliance records, not an EPA grade, laboratory result, health recommendation, or guarantee of present water quality.

EPA contaminant categories in violation records

EPA categoryClassificationRecords
Haloacetic Acids (HAA5)Health-based record4
Lead and Copper RuleHealth-based record2
Total Trihalomethanes (TTHMs)Health-based record1
CadmiumMonitoring/reporting record1
ArsenicMonitoring/reporting record1
FluorideMonitoring/reporting record1
ThalliumMonitoring/reporting record1

These are compliance records associated with an EPA contaminant code, not current tap-water test results or proof that a substance is presently detected.
